Household of Jacob Philippuszoon Bakker

He is married to Trijntje Kikkert.

They got married on January 6, 1876 at Texel, Noord-Holland, he was 23 years old.Source 1

Vader bruidegom: Philippus Bakker
Moeder bruidegom: Geertje Koning
Vader bruid: Pieter Klaaszoon Kikkert
Moeder bruid: Marretje Zuidewind
Nadere informatie: beroep bg.: zeeman; beroep vader bg.: schipper; voogd van de bruid Joan R.G. Coninck Westenberg; toeziend voogd van de bruid Jacob Zuidewind

Child(ren):

  1. Pieter Bakker  1877-1965
